PCBA production involves a detailed process of steps to construct printed electrical boards. This explanation will examine the critical elements of the full manufacturing cycle. Initially, layout development and material selection are necessary. Following that, the base undergoes routing, patterning, and coating deposition. Next, component positioning – both component fastening (SMT) and through-hole – occurs, followed by bonding and verification. Finally, operational assessment and packaging conclude the whole PCBA creation process.
Grasping Circuit Board Fabrication Processes and Quality Control
The creation of PCBA's involves a complex series of essential processes . This encompasses everything from element setting and joining to testing and ultimate inspection. Thorough quality oversight is crucial at each stage to confirm dependability and performance . This usually involves automated optical analysis (AOI), X-ray inspection for hidden defects, and in-circuit verification to prove the accuracy of the constructed board. Addressing potential issues proactively is key to delivering a superior unit.
Printed Circuit Board Assembly Layout Aspects for Peak Functionality
Effective PCB Assembly architecture necessitates careful consideration of various aspects. Signal purity is critical, requiring accurate trace planning and impedance matching. Thermal management must be considered early, utilizing effective vias and layer stackups to remove temperature. Device positioning directly impacts data path distance and potential noise interference. Finally, manufacturing processes and verification demands should be included into the design from the outset to provide stability and expense efficiency.

Printed Circuit Board Assembly Testing and Inspection: Maintaining Functionality
Rigorous Printed Circuit Board examination and scrutiny are essential steps in guaranteeing the dependability of a finished product. This procedure involves a sequence of approaches, from visual assessment for visible defects to automated optical verification (AOI), X-ray inspection, and in-circuit evaluation. These processes reveal latent errors early in the manufacturing cycle, decreasing the probability of customer problems and finally enhancing overall product quality.
